i have a 99 toyota sienna van that one of the steel rims is out of round causing a vibration...must have hit pothole..

jumk yard has for 25 to 45 $ vs dealer new $125....

would you go with the junk yard rim...why or why not?

Answer
Bob,

Yup!  Junkyard...er...Auto Recycling Center parts get my vote for the cheapest stuff when durability is probably not an issue!  That means wheels, axles, driveshafts.  Not water pumps, alternators.

But what I would do is go down there and make sure they will trade for another if it turns out to be out of round.  Then I would have a dial indicator put on it to make sure it is OK.  About 0.015" runout - peak to peak - would be good.  If you can find a guy with a Hunter GSP9700, so much the better.  Then you want a runout of 0.010"
